Warm Crockpot Christmas Punch

Ingredients

(Tip: You’ll find the full list of ingredients and measurements in the recipe card below.)
apple juice or apple cider
cranberry juice
pineapple juice
fresh lemon juice
white sugar
brown sugar
cinnamon stick
whole cloves
star anise
ground nutmeg
ground ginger

optional garnish: sliced apples, orange slices, fresh cranberries

Directions

Add the apple juice, cranberry juice, pineapple juice, and lemon juice to your slow cooker.
Stir in the white sugar and brown sugar until dissolved.
Add the cinnamon stick, cloves, star anise, nutmeg, and ginger.
Cover and cook on low for 3 to 4 hours until hot and fragrant.
Taste and adjust sweetness or spices if needed.
Add sliced fruit for garnish just before serving.
Serve warm directly from the crockpot.

Servings and timing

Servings: 8 to 10 servings
Prep time: 10 minutes
Cook time: 3 to 4 hours
Total time: about 3 hours 10 minutes to 4 hours 10 minutes

Variations

For a spiked version, add rum, red wine, or amaretto just before serving.
Swap pineapple juice with orange juice for a slightly different citrus profile.
Use honey or maple syrup instead of sugar for a more natural sweetness.
Add fresh ginger slices for a stronger spicy kick.
Include vanilla extract for a subtle depth of flavor.

Storage/Reheating

Store any leftover punch in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
Reheat gently on the stovetop over low heat or return it to the slow cooker on warm until heated through.
Avoid boiling during reheating to preserve the flavor balance.

FAQs

Can I make this punch 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are it a day in advance and reheat it gently before serving.

Can I use fresh fruit instead of juice?

Juices are recommended for consistency, but you can enhance the flavor with fresh fruit slices.

Is this recipe kid-friendly?

Yes, as long as you keep it non-alcoholic, it’s perfect for all ages.

Can I cook this on the stovetop instead?

Yes, simmer it gently on low heat for about 30 to 40 minutes.

How do I keep it warm for a party?

Leave it in the slow cooker on the warm setting and stir occasionally.

Can I reduce the sugar?

Yes, adjust the sugar to taste or skip it if your juices are already sweet.

What spices can I substitute?

You can use allspice or a premixed spice blend if you don’t have the listed spices.

Can I freeze leftover punch?

Freezing is not recommended as it may alter the flavor and texture.

How do I make it stronger in flavor?

Add more spices or let it cook slightly longer to intensify the flavors.

Can I make a larger batch?

Yes, simply double the ingredients as long as your slow cooker can accommodate the volume.
